Renewable energy sources like solar and wind power are no longer niche alternatives; they are becoming mainstream. In the U.S., solar panel installations have seen exponential growth, driven by falling costs and supportive federal and state incentives. Similarly, wind farms, both onshore and offshore, are expanding their reach, contributing significantly to the nation’s electricity generation. The Inflation Reduction Act (IRA), for instance, has provided substantial tax credits and incentives for renewable energy projects, accelerating investment and deployment. For example, in 2023, renewable energy sources accounted for a significant portion of new electricity-generating capacity added to the U.S. grid. A practical tip for homeowners interested in solar is to research local incentives and net metering policies, which can significantly reduce the upfront cost and improve the return on investment. The automotive sector is undergoing a seismic shift with the rapid adoption of electric vehicles (EVs). Major automakers are investing billions in EV production, and consumer interest is soaring, fueled by environmental concerns, lower running costs, and improving battery technology. The U.S. government has set ambitious targets for EV adoption, supported by tax credits for purchasing new and used EVs, as well as investments in charging infrastructure. States like California have been at the forefront, setting mandates for zero-emission vehicle sales. However, challenges remain, including the need for a more robust and accessible charging network across the country, particularly in rural areas, and ensuring the ethical sourcing of battery materials. A statistic to consider: By 2030, it’s projected that a substantial percentage of new vehicle sales in the U.S. could be electric. Achieving net-zero emissions requires more than just cleaning up our electricity grid and transportation. It means tackling emissions from heavy industry, agriculture, and other sectors that are harder to electrify. This involves developing and deploying innovative technologies such as carbon capture, utilization, and storage (CCUS), as well as exploring the potential of green hydrogen as a clean fuel source for industrial processes and heavy-duty transport. The Bipartisan Infrastructure Law includes funding for CCUS projects and research into clean hydrogen. For example, several pilot projects are underway across the U.S. to demonstrate the viability of these technologies in sectors like cement and steel production. A practical step businesses can take is to conduct energy audits to identify areas for efficiency improvements and explore options for electrifying their operations where possible. Effective environmental policy is crucial for driving the clean energy transition. This includes a mix of regulations, market-based mechanisms like carbon pricing, and public investments. Public opinion plays a vital role, and building broad support for climate action is essential for sustained progress. Engaging communities, addressing concerns about job transitions, and ensuring equitable access to clean energy benefits are key to fostering a just transition. Recent polls indicate a growing public concern about climate change and a desire for stronger government action. For instance, bipartisan support for certain clean energy initiatives, like investments in grid modernization, demonstrates that common ground can be found. A key takeaway is that clear communication about the benefits of clean energy – from job creation to improved public health – is vital for building and maintaining public buy-in.
